Understanding the Rules of LuxorGold
Before venturing into the depths of LuxorGold, players must acquaint themselves with its core mechanics and rules. At its heart, LuxorGold is a strategy game that demands a balance between resource management and tactical prowess. Here are some key aspects to understand:
Gameplay Mechanics
LuxorGold integrates a dynamic combination of puzzle-solving and exploration. Players are tasked with navigating through various terrains and unlocking secrets embedded within ancient structures. Every action taken by the player, from deciphering hieroglyphics to engaging in trade with NPCs (non-playable characters), must be meticulously planned and executed.
Resource Management
In LuxorGold, the effective management of resources is crucial. Collecting gold, artifacts, and special items helps advance the player's quest. However, players must remain vigilant, as scarcity of resources can present significant challenges, demanding strategic foresight in planning resource allocation and usage.
Combat Features
The journey through LuxorGold is not devoid of dangers. Players must often engage in combat scenarios that require both offensive and defensive strategies. Securing powerful allies and upgrading equipment are vital strategies for overcoming challenges posed by mythological creatures and rival factions that lurk within the shadows of the desert.
